Apple, brie, and blueberry galette

Serves   6
Prep time: 20 mins
Cooking time: 30 mins

This rustic galette layers golden flaky pastry with warm spiced apples, gooey brie, and a tangy blueberry compote. The balance of sweet, tart, and creamy makes it a total showstopper that won’t take all day to make! Add a scoop of ice cream for an indulgent dessert.

Ingredients

  • 1 ½ cups frozen blueberries 
  • 2 tsp brown sugar, plus extra for crust 
  • 1 tsp lemon juice 
  • 1 tsp cornstarch  
  • 1 sheet ready-made puff pastry  
  • 1 small wheel of Brie 
  • 1 apple 
  • 1 egg, beaten  
  • 1 tsp cinnamon 

Method

  1. In a small saucepan, combine frozen blueberries, 2 tsp brown sugar, and lemon juice. 
  2. Heat over medium-low heat, stirring occasionally, for about 5 minutes or until the blueberries soften and release their juices. 
  3. Dissolve the cornstarch in 1 tbsp of water and stir it into the blueberry mixture. Simmer for an additional 1-2 minutes until the compote thickens. 
  4. Remove from heat. Leave roughly half of the blueberry compote in the pan and transfer the other half to a bowl to use later.  
  5. Preheat the oven to 200°C bake. 
  6. Place the puff pastry sheet onto a tray lined with baking paper. 
  7. Spoon the blueberry compote remaining in your saucepan into the centre of the pastry, spreading it evenly, but leaving a border of about 5cm around the edges. 
  8. Slice the Brie lengthways into even slices and arrange them evenly over the blueberry base.  
  9. Thinly slice your apple. Fan 4 or so slices of apple out at a time and place over the brie. Repeat this, placing the apple fans in different directions for a fun pattern.  
  10. Fold the edges of the pastry over the filling and press to seal. Brush with the beaten egg.  
  11. Sprinkle some brown sugar and the cinnamon over the pastry and the filling too.  
  12. Bake the galette for 30–40 minutes, or until the crust is golden and crispy and the apples are tender. 
  13. Spoon the reserved half blueberry compote on top before serving, warm or cold.  

Top tips:

  • Add a scoop of vanilla ice cream for an extra indulgent dessert!   
  • Alternatively, you can microwave the blueberry mixture on high for 2-3 minutes, stirring halfway through. Stir well afterwards.
